Publisher's summary

One of the greatest of all English novels, a finely etched satire about the scatterbrained Mrs. Bennett, whose aim in life is to see her five daughters married. Meet Jane Austen's rich and varied characters: the proud Mr. Darcy; the pompous parson Mr. Collins, who seeks the most advantageous match for himself; good-humored Mr. Bingley; and, of course, the two eldest Bennett daughters, Jane and Elizabeth.

Jane Lapotaire is wonderful!

Even though this version of Pride and Prejudice is abridged, I was delighted to find it here. I grew up listening to this one and a cassette tape. Jane Lapotaire is a fabulous narrator and tells the story through the characters in a very engaging way. If you want to enjoy a shortened version, for about two hours, this gives you a great idea of the overall story and it’s enjoyable to listen to! Since most of the film adaptions for the most part have edited out much of the book as well, this is a lot like watching a film adaption, except it is listening to a narrated audio book.
